1580Thought crimeEvery repressive regime seeks to control free thought as it is expressed in literature, or in the classroom, at some point. In 1580, the Privy Council warns all diocese against the corruptive influence of Catholic sympathizers in schools. In towns like Stratford, where the majority of schoolmasters were old Catholics, State informers are primed to report any behavior by teachers that might be considered disloyal to the crown. |
